Four dioxidomolybdenum(VI) complexes of the general structure [MoO2L2] employing the S,N-bidentate ligands pyrimidine-2-thiolate (PymS, 1), pyridine-2-thiolate (PyS, 2), 4-methylpyridine-2-thiolate (4-MePyS, 3) and 6-methylpyridine-2-thiolate (6-MePyS, 4) were synthesized and characterized by spectroscopic means and single-crystal x-ray diffraction anal. (2-4). Complexes 1-4 were reacted with PPh3 and PMe3, resp., to investigate their oxygen atom transfer (OAT) reactivity and catalytic applicability. Reduction with PPh3 leads to sym. molybdenum(V) dimers of the general structure [Mo2O3L4] (6-9). Kinetic studies showed that the OAT from [MoO2L2] to PPh3 is 5 times faster for the PymS system than for the PyS and 4-MePyS systems. The reaction of complexes 1-3 with PMe3 gives stable molybdenum(IV) complexes of the structure [MoOL2(PMe3)2] (10-12), while reduction of [MoO2(6-MePyS)2] (4) yields [MoO(6-MePyS)2(PMe3)] (13) with only one PMe3 coordinated to the metal center. The activity of complexes 1-4 in catalytic OAT reactions involving Me2SO and Ph2SO as oxygen donors and PPh3 as an oxygen acceptor has been investigated to assess the influence of the varied ligand frameworks on the OAT reaction rates. It was found that [MoO2(PymS)2] (1) and [MoO2(6-MePyS)2] (4) are similarly efficient catalysts, while complexes 2 and 3 are only moderately active. In the catalytic oxidation of PMe3 with Me2SO, complex 4 is the only efficient catalyst. Complexes 1-4 were also found to catalytically reduce NO3- with PPh3, although their reactivity is inhibited by further reduced species such as NO, as exemplified by the formation of the nitrosyl complex [Mo(NO)(PymS)3] (14), which was identified by single-crystal x-ray diffraction anal. Computed ΔG values for the very first step of the OAT were lower for complexes 1 and 4 than for 2 and 3, explaining the difference in catalytic reactivity between the two pairs and revealing the requirement for an electron-deficient ligand system. The syntheses, characterization, and catalytic OAT activity of four dioxidomolybdenum(VI) complexes employing different S,N-bidentate ligands are reported.

A Lewis base supported terminal U phosphinidene, [η5-1,3-(Me3C)2C5H3]2U(:P-2,4,6-tBu3C6H2)(OPMe3) (5), is isolated from the reaction of the U Me chloride [η5-1,3-(Me3C)2C5H3]2U(Cl)Me (4) with 2,4,6-(Me3C)3C6H2PHK in toluene in the presence of Me3PO. Also, the reactivity of the U phospinidene 5 toward small mols. were comprehensively explored. While no reactivity of 5 with internal alkynes is observed attributed to steric hindrance, it readily reacts with various small mols. including isothiocyanates, aldehydes, imines, diazenes, carbodiimides, nitriles, isonitriles, and organic azides, yielding U sulfides, oxides, metallaheterocycles, and imido complexes, in good yields. A Lewis base supported actinide phosphinidene metallocene was isolated and its reactivity toward small mols. was studied. It exhibits a rich reaction chem. toward a variety of heterounsatd. mols. and the steric hindrance imposed by the Cp ligand plays an important role in the formation and reaction chem. of U phosphinidene metallocenes.

The catalytic performance of two different MOFs, UiO-66 and MOF-808, containing Lewis acid active sites has been evaluated for the transformation of glucose in water and compared with that of analogous Lewis acid Zr-β zeolite. While fructose is the main product obtained on Zr-β, mannose production increases when using Zr-MOFs as catalysts. Kinetic studies reveal a lower activation energy barrier for glucose epimerization to mannose when using Zr-MOF catalysts (~83-88 and ~100 kJ/mol for glucose epimerization and isomerization, resp.). A 13C NMR study using 13C1-labeled glucose allows confirming that on Zr-MOF catalysts, mannose is exclusively formed following the glucose epimerization route through a 1,2-intramol. carbon shift, whereas the two-step glucose → fructose → mannose isomerization via 1,2-intramol. proton shifts is the preferred pathway on Zr-β. A computational study reveals a different mode of adsorption of deprotonated glucose on Zr-MOFs that allows decreasing the activation barrier for the 1,2-intramol. carbon shift. The combination of spectroscopic, kinetic, and theor. studies allows unraveling the nature of the metal sites in Zr-MOFs and Zr-β catalysts and to propose a structure-activity relationship between the different Lewis acid sites and the glucose transformation reactions. The results presented here could permit new rationalized MOF catalyst designs with the specific active sites to facilitate particular reaction mechanisms. The combination of spectroscopic, kinetic, and theor. studies allows unraveling the nature of the metal sites in Zr-metal-organic framework (Zr-MOF) catalysts for glucose transformation reactions.

The Lewis base supported terminal uranium phosphinidene metallocene [η5-1,3-(Me3C)2C5H3]2U(=P-2,4,6-iPr3C6H2)(OPMe3) (2) could be isolated from a salt metathesis reaction in toluene at ambient temperature between [η5-1,3-(Me3C)2C5H3]2U(Cl)Me (1) and 2,4,6-iPr3C6H2PHK in the presence of Me3PO, and its structure and reactivity were probed in detail. No reaction of 2 with internal alkynes was observed, but it reacts in the presence of various heterounsatd. mols. such as CS2, isothiocyanates, aldehydes, imines, diazenes, carbodiimides, nitriles, isonitriles, diazoalkane, and organic azides, forming carbodithioates, sulfidos, oxidos, metallaheterocycles, and imido complexes, in good yields. Moreover, on reaction with the diazoalkane derivative Me3SiCHN2 the pseudophosphinimido uranium(III) complex [η5-1,3-(Me3C)2C5H3]2U(N=P-2,4,6-iPr3C6H2)(OPMe3) (20) can be isolated in good yield.

Characterization of the acidic properties of solid acid catalysts is essential to understanding their catalytic performance with respect to activity, deactivation rate and product selectivity. In this work, trimethylphosphine (TMP) was used as a probe mol. for the study of acidity in a HY zeolite activated at 773 K. The variations in type, concentration and acid strength with the desorption temperature of the probe mol. were followed by IR spectroscopy (FT-IR) and solid-state NMR (ss-NMR). Oxidation of TMP to trimethylphosphine oxide (TMPO) provided addnl. information about Bronsted (BAS) and Lewis (LAS) acid sites with different acid strengths. The variation in acid strength of certain species determined by calculating the concentration percentage of the desorption and reabsorption of the majority species by increasing the desorption temperature The 31P ss-NMR chem. shifts at δ = -62, -32 to -58, 45 and 51 ppm correspond to weak acid sites (<423 K). The peaks at δ = 54 and 55 ppm arose from medium acid sites (423-623 K). The strong acid sites at δ = 58, 61, 63, 64, 65, 67, 70, 73, 76 and 80 ppm correspond to sites with different acid strengths (>623 K). Our results demonstrated differences in the concentrations of acid and the distribution of acid strengths of extra-framework (EFAl) aluminum species in different cavities by varying the desorption temperature of the probe mol. The developed methodol. provides more detailed information about acidic properties and can be used for solid acid catalysts using alkylphosphines and their oxides as probe mols.

Phosphoryl ligands of the general formula O:PR3 (R = Me, OMe, Et, nBu, Ph, iPr, NMe2) were coordinated to [Nd(TriNOx)] (TriNOx3- = [(2-tBuNO)C6H4CH2]3N)3- and characterized. Solution equilibrium constants for each complex were determined, demonstrating a large range for phosphoryl ligands Lewis basicity. Thermogravimetric analyses provided evidence for the qual. thermodn. preference of phosphoryl ligands for [Nd(TriNOx)] over the dysprosium analog. These findings were exploited for the separation of binary mixtures of neodymium/dysprosium and lanthanum/neodymium. Implementation of phosphoryl ligands in the TriNOx separation system expands its scope and demonstrates a fundamentally different mode for separating rare-earth cations based on adducts with neutral donors.

Supramol. adducts between dimethyl-2,2,3,3-tetracyanocyclopropane (Me2TCCP) with 21 small (polar) mols. and 10 anions were computed with DFT (B3LYP-D3/def2-TZVP). Their optimized geometries were used to obtain interaction energies, and perform energy decomposition and ‘atoms-in-mols.’ analyses. A set of 38 other adducts were also evaluated for comparison purposes. Selected examples were further scrutinized by inspection of the mol. electrostatic potential maps, Noncovalent Interaction index plots, the Laplacian, the orbital interactions, and by estimating the Gibbs free energy of complexation in hexane solution These calculations divulge the thermodn. feasibility of Me2TCCP adducts and show that complexation is typically driven by dispersion with less polarized partners, but by orbital interactions when more polarized or anionic guests are deployed. Most Me2TCCP adducts are more stable than simple hydrogen bonding with water, but less stable than traditional Lewis adducts involving Me3B, or a strong halogen bond such as with Br2. Several bonding analyses showed that the locus of interaction is found near the electron poor sp3-hydridized (NC)2C-C(CN)2 carbon atoms. An empty hybrid σ*/π* orbital on Me2TCCP was identified that can be held responsible for the stability of the most stable adducts due to donor-acceptor interactions.

It remains difficult to understand the surface of solid acid catalysts at the mol. level, despite their importance for industrial catalytic applications. A sulfated zirconium-based metal-organic framework, MOF-808-SO4, was previously shown to be a strong solid Bronsted acid material. In this report, we probe the origin of its acidity through an array of spectroscopic, crystallog. and computational characterization techniques. The strongest Bronsted acid site is shown to consist of a specific arrangement of adsorbed water and sulfate moieties on the zirconium clusters. When a water mol. adsorbs to one zirconium atom, it participates in a hydrogen bond with a sulfate moiety that is chelated to a neighboring zirconium atom; this motif, in turn, results in the presence of a strongly acidic proton. On dehydration, the material loses its acidity. The hydrated sulfated MOF exhibits a good catalytic performance for the dimerization of isobutene (2-methyl-1-propene), and achieves a 100% selectivity for C8 products with a good conversion efficiency.

Three different strains of Saccharomyces cerevisiae – D15, Dibosh and 71B – were evaluated in the fermentation of Lonicera edulis wines. Volatile aromatic components were analyzed by gas chromatog.-mass spectrometry coupled with headspace solid-phase microextraction In all, 81 volatile compounds were identified in L. edulis wines, including 43, 48 and 38 individually found in wines fermented with D15, Dibosh and 71B. There were 17 common volatile aromatic components found in all the three L. edulis wines. The main volatile compounds in wines fermented with D15 and Dibosh yeasts were 2-methyl-1-butanol (24.8%) and hexane (20.6%). Pentanol was the primary volatile aromatic compound in wines produced with S. cerevisiae 71B, accounting for 40.8% of total volatile aromatic compounds Combining the sensory anal., S. cerevisiae D15 was suggested to be the most suitable strain for producing L. edulis wine.
